In Sanilac County, your loved one is booked into the Sanilac County Jail at 65 North Elk Street in Sandusky. That's Sandusky, Michigan, the county seat in the Thumb, not Sandusky, Ohio. From there, arraignment takes place in the 73A District Court at the Sanilac County Courthouse, 60 West Sanilac Avenue, Sandusky, where a judge or magistrate advises the charges and sets bond. Misdemeanors generally remain in the 73A District Court for trial. Felonies begin there with arraignment and a preliminary examination, and if the judge finds probable cause the case is bound over to the 24th Circuit Court of Sanilac County in the same courthouse. Whatever the judge sets, we post surety bonds throughout Michigan for the state-regulated 10% premium, so you pay a manageable fraction instead of the entire bail.
